The ingredients needed to make Kiwi Chocolate Fudge Cheesecake:
  1. Get Crust:
  2. Get 1 cup dates medjool
  3. Get 1 cup hemp seeds / walnuts
  4. Get pinch cinnamon
  5. Take 1/4 tsp sea salt
  6. Make ready Filling:
  7. Make ready 3 cups cashews raw , soaked for 2+hours
  8. Prepare 1/2 cup coconut oil , melted
  9. Prepare 1 lemon , juiced
  10. Prepare 4 kiwi fruit
  11. Get 1/4 cup cacao raw powder
  12. Take 1/4 tsp stevia
  13. Take 1/4 cup maple syrup honey / agave syrup raw
  14. Get 1/4 tsp sea salt
  15. Take 1/8 cup water (least amount possible)
  16. Prepare 1 tbsp cacao paste*optional(for the real fudge feel) or
  17. Take 2 tbsps cacao nibs
  18. Make ready cream to serve, nice-!
  19. Make ready 4 bananas frozen , blended until smooth
Steps to make Kiwi Chocolate Fudge Cheesecake:
  1. Line a pie dish with plastic wrap. You could also use a springform pan. Melt the coconut oil by placing it in a jar, in a bowl and running it under hot water for a minute or so, letting it sit in the hot water. Continue to run the water if you need. If using cacao paste, add it to the coconut oil.
  2. Add all crust ingredients to food processor or blender, process until a doughy ball forms.
  3. Transfer to pie dish and flatten out with your hands or a spoon. Be sure to get the crust as even as possible.
  4. Set in the freezer while you make the filling.
  5. Rinse cashews well, add to blender or food processor, juice the lemon and blend.
  6. Starting with 1 Tbsp of water, continue running the processor or blender trying to grind the cashews as much as possible.
  7. While the blender or processor is running, add the liquified coconut oil/cacao paste very slowly. If you don't have a feed tube, simply add the oil and blend.
  8. Finally add 2 kiwis, cacao powder, and sea salt and blend.
  9. Pour the filling into the pie pan or springform pan and freeze for at least 3 hours to set. When ready to eat, it is recommended to first move to the fridge for about an hour, and then let it sit out. If you don't have time, simply let it thaw until slightly firm but not hard. Goes great with banana ice cream!(nice-cream) To make, freeze 4 bananas and blend until smooth!
  10. Top with remaining 2 kiwis, banana ice cream and enjoy
